English
Language : 

M16C62_N Datasheet, PDF (518/621 Pages) Renesas Technology Corp – 16-BIT SINGLE-CHIP MICROCOMPUTER M16C FAMILY
Interrupt
Mitsubishi microcomputers
M16C / 62 Group
SINGLE-CHIP 16-BIT CMOS MICROCOMPUTER
Time
Interrupt request
generated
Reset
Interrupt 1
Interrupt priority level = 3
Main routine
I=0
IPL = 0
I=1
Interrupt 2
Interrupt priority level = 5
Interrupt 3
Interrupt priority level = 2
Figure 4.6.1. Multiple interrupts
Nesting
Interrupt 1
I=0
IPL = 3
I=1
Multiple interrupts
Interrupt 2
I=0
IPL = 5
REIT
I=1
REIT
I=1
IPL = 3
Interrupt 3
Not acknowledged because
of low interrupt priority
IPL = 0
Interrupt 3
I=0
IPL = 2
Main routine instructions
are not executed.
REIT
I=1
IPL = 0
I : Interrupt enable flag
IPL : Processor interrupt priority level
: Automatically executed.
: Be sure to set in software.
503